Verkamp's Curios is a long-established Native American arts and gift store located at the Grand Canyon, founded by John Verkamp Sr. in 1906, well before the area was designated as a National Park. The store has been family-owned and operated for generations, with John’s descendants continuing the business tradition into the present day.
Situated just east of Hopi House along the rim trail, Verkamp's offers a unique selection of Native American crafts and gifts, reflecting the rich cultural heritage of the region. The store has maintained its charm and commitment to quality over the decades, making it a cherished destination for visitors to the Grand Canyon.
